Summary

Dr. Bernard Mason is an internal medicine physician who specializes in hematology and oncology. He earned his medical degree from the prestigious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ania and completed his residency at Fox Chase Cancer Center. With 54 years of clinical experience, Dr. Mason brings extensive knowledge to the treatment of blood disorders and cancer care.

Dr. Mason practices in multiple locations throughout the Philadelphia area, including Merion Station and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. His decades of experience have established him as a seasoned specialist in treating patients with complex hematologic and oncologic conditions.
